New Ulm, MN - The Crown College Polars Softball team faced off with the Martin Luther Knights on Tuesday and won both by scores of 8-6 and 10-3.
A three run first inning gave Crown an early lead in game one. Singles from
Catelyn Garza,
Emmy Romportl, and
Maria Lilienthal loaded the bases up.
Ashley Earick stepped up to the plate and drove three runs with a bases clearing triple. Martin Luther however swung the game in their direction scoring 6 unanswered runs to put the Polars down 6-3. A quiet 4th, 5th, and 6th innings brought the Polars back up for their final at bats in the first contest. A leadoff walk from Earick and back to back doubles from
Morgan Aylsworth and
Madi Hecox cut the Knights lead to 6-5. A walk and three straight singles for Crown gave the Polars an 8-6 and it would stay there giving Crown the victory.
Maria Lilienthal led the offense with three hits in four at bats.
Emmy Romportl and
Morgan Aylsworth both notched two hits in the contest. The Polars totaled 11 hits as a team.
Emmy Romportl pitched a complete game and scattered 8 hits only allowing 2 earned runs in the contest getting her second win of the season.
Crown's bats started hot out of the gate scoring three runs in the first off of a walk and two hits. A huge top of the second saw Crown score five more runs after a six hit inning. The Knights notched one run in the second and two in the bottom of the third. Two more runs from Crown gave the Polars a 10-3 lead and they cruised to a two game sweep of Martin Luther.
